Why Fun Novelty Toys Keep Customers Coming Back
People do not just remember what they bought, they remember how they felt while buying it. A silly desk toy, a squishy stress ball or a quirky puzzle can turn a normal shop visit into something that feels light and playful. That tiny spark of joy often stands out more than the main item they came in for.
Fun novelty toys at the counter, in themed displays or near key categories can:
- Break tension after a long workday
- Make kids smile during a boring errand
- Turn a rushed “grab and go” trip into a relaxed browse
We also see the “little treat” mindset at play. A shopper might throw in a small toy as a reward for a child, a gag gift for a friend or a pick-me-up for themselves. When those treats are easy to spot, well priced and regularly refreshed, adding one becomes a natural habit.
There is also the story factor. Items that are funny, unusual or just very cute are made to be shared. People pull them out at the office, post them on social media or show them to family at home. That kind of talk spreads your store name without any hard sell, and often leads to new visitors saying, “I saw this in a friend’s house and had to come find it.”
Choosing the Right Fun Novelty Toys Wholesale Range
Not every novelty toy suits every shopper. The best ranges are built with clear customer groups in mind. A family-heavy store might focus on bright colours, tactile toys and pocket-money prices. A city gift shop near offices might lean into stress toys, desk games and funny, slightly cheeky items. Tourist areas might do well with Aussie-themed novelties that double as light, easy-to-pack souvenirs.
To shape a smart mix, it helps to think about:
- Who shops with you the most, and at what times
- What moods they are usually in when they visit
- Which products they already love in your store
Quality and safety matter just as much as fun. Toys that break quickly or feel flimsy can damage trust in your store, not just in that one product. Working with an experienced wholesaler that focuses on durable and compliant items helps protect your brand and encourages customers to come back with confidence.
There is also a balance between trends and evergreen winners. Trend-led pieces tied to current themes, colours or pop culture are great for a buzz, especially around winter school holidays, Father’s Day, Halloween and early Christmas planning. Alongside those, it pays to keep reliable classics on shelf, like:
- Puzzles and brain teasers
- Stress and fidget toys
- Mini desk games and office toys
- Simple DIY craft or activity kits
This mix keeps your store feeling fresh while reducing the risk of being stuck with stock that dates too quickly.
Strategic Merchandising That Sparks Repeat Visits
Fun novelty toys wholesale only pay off if people can see them and reach them easily. Placement is powerful. End caps, counter displays and clear “fun zones” invite shoppers to pause, touch, squeeze and laugh. Those few extra seconds of engagement are often all it takes to add one more item to the basket.
Smart cross-merchandising can push basket value even higher. You might:
- Place playful toys next to greeting cards and gift wrap
- Pair desk toys with stationery, planners and notebooks
- Add novelty items beside winter warmers for EOFY staff gifts
- Build small party tables mixing toys with candles and homewares
Signage helps a lot too. Short, cheeky signs like “Little Laughs Under $15” or “Quick Gifts for Boring Meetings” lower the mental barrier. Shoppers feel they can try something new without overthinking it or feeling guilty. Clear price cues, tidy displays and an obvious “pick me up” feel all work together to make repeat buying easy.
Seasonal Campaigns and Loyalty Drivers
Fun becomes even more powerful when it is planned around the local retail calendar. In Australia, we have a strong rhythm through EOFY corporate gifting, winter school holidays, Father’s Day, Halloween and the early stages of Christmas lists. Each of these moments is a chance to turn gifting into an ongoing habit.
You can build patterns that customers start to expect, such as:
- Monthly novelty drops with a small new theme each time
- “Friday Fun” promos that reward end-of-week visits
- Seasonal feature tables that change with the weather and events
Over time, shoppers learn that there is always something new and cheeky waiting, which gives them a reason to pop back in, even when they do not strictly need anything.
Data and feedback make these campaigns stronger. It helps to keep an eye on:
- Which novelty products sell out fastest
- Which themes spark comments at the counter
- Which times of year see big spikes in small impulse buys
Those clues help you fine-tune your wholesale orders, so each new season is better matched to what your customers enjoy most.
Alongside campaigns, structured loyalty tools can turn casual fans into regulars. Bundling small toys with related gifts or homewares encourages people to buy a set instead of a single item. Simple loyalty clubs or VIP lists can then give repeat buyers early access to fresh novelties, member-only offers or birthday surprises tied to your fun ranges. When people feel like “insiders” on the latest quirky arrivals, they naturally check in more often, both in-store and online.
